about 2 hours ago
Base Salary
$205k - $245k/yr
Responsibilities
- Provide technical direction for back end systems and APIs for data processing.
- Contribute to architecture discussions and design reviews.
- Collaborate with engineers, designers, and product managers to implement product designs.
- Design, develop, test, and maintain robust code.
- Create test plans and automated tests to ensure product features work as expected.
- Mentor and coach junior engineers on code design and implementation.
- Contribute to internal and external blogs to engage users.
- Be available for stand-by, on-call, or off-hours duties.
Requirements
- Experience building products that leverage large scale data sets using Node.js, Typescript, and React.
- Ability to learn new technologies and develop prototypes quickly.
- Strong knowledge of data structures, algorithms, and distributed systems.
- Experience with developing and using REST APIs.
- Familiarity with Agile processes and rapid iterative development.
- Strong sense of ownership focused on high quality deliverables.
- Experience developing services for cloud-based platforms.
- Must comply with U.S. government security requirements for FedRAMP-authorized systems.
Benefits
- Generous benefits package including health, dental, and vision insurance.
- Paid holidays and paid time off.
- Fertility treatment benefit.
- 401(k) plan.
- Equity options.